N-Benzoyl-Val-Gly-Arg p-nitroanilide hydrochloride is a fluorogenic substrate renowned for its ability to detect and quantify β-glucuronidase activity. With its exceptional purity and quality, this substrate is widely preferred for applications such as food testing and staining. Moreover, N-Benzoyl-Val-Gly-Arg p-nitroanilide hydrochloride serves as a highly sensitive synthetic chromogenic peptide substrate, particularly valuable in assessing Urokinase activity. Its reliability and efficacy make it an indispensable tool for precise determination in various scientific investigations and analytical assays.
